It is the 31st century, a time of endless wars that rage across human-occupied space. As star empires clash, these epic wars are won and lost by BattleMechs, 30-foot-tall humanoid metal titans bristling with lasers, autocannons and dozens of other lethal weapons; enough firepower to level entire city blocks. Your elite force of MechWarriors drives these juggernauts into battle, proudly holding your faction's flag high, intent on expanding the power and glory of your realm. At their beck and call are the support units of armored vehicles, power armored infantry, aerospace fighters and more, wielded by a MechWarrior's skillful command to aid him in ultimate victory. Will they become legends, or forgotten casualties? Only your skill and luck will determine their fate!
The product of more than twenty years of gaming experience, Total Warfare presents the rules of the Classic BattleTech game system as never before. For the first time, all the rules for various units that have a direct impact on the deadly battlefields of the thirty-first century appear in a unified rules set: from BattleMechs to ProtoMechs, Combat Vehicles to Support Vehicles, infantry to aerospace fighters and DropShips. Interwoven and meticulously updated, Total Warfare provides the most detailed and comprehensive rules set published to date for BattleTech - the perfect companion for standard tournament play.
Total Warfare is the single-source rulebook for people who play Classic BattleTech. It is not intended to teach new players the game, but rather to serve as a reference work for people who know the game, while introducing more technologies and expansive rules than appear in the basic box set. The introductory game in the BattleTech line is the Classic BattleTech Introductory Box Set. New players should pick up that product before diving into this one.

Short point: If you're out to crash giant robots into each other and no more, this book isn't for you. Stick to the basic CBT starter set and be happy.

Long point: If, on the other hand, you realize that the average war isn't solely dependent on giant robots for the win, this is the right book for you. Having been a BT4 player since just after 2000 (I've had pages fall out of my copies of BT Master Rules and Maximum Tech, they are so heavily used), it is good to see a nice chunk of L1, L2 and L3 Battletech codified and compiled into one easy reference. It is a big book, and for some things you will have to hunt and read until you memorize it, but for the one-stop slaughterhouse in the Inner Sphere and Clan territories, this is well worth the sticker price. The authors even went so far as to chop up Aerotech and throw in the ground support system for good measure.

The downsides: Artillery is not covered in this volume. The space battle section of the Aerotech coverage only goes as far as Dropships, leaving Jumpships and Warships out entirely. The largest downside is simple: this is only the play rules. If you want to build your own units (one of the great hallmarks of Battletech), you will need the sister volume CBT Techmanual (Classic Battletech).

Rating Justification: Four out of five stars is well worth it, simply because they compacted and simplified a very large amount of BT4 into one play-oriented volume. It would have been nice to have the full spectrum of combat in one volume (Arty, space naval engagements, odds and ends not included here), but it is also logical that such concerns be handled in a more strategic setting (hence the third book, CBT Tactical Operations (Classic Battletech)).

First let me tell everyone that if you are looking to get into Battletech this is not the manual to begin with. You want to start with the Battletech Introductory Box Set with its simplified rules on mech combat and starter materials (map sheets, miniatures, and reference sheets). When you decide that you like Battletech and that you crave more than what the introduction rules can give you (You want to see heightened realism, tanks, infantry, urban warfare, combined arms - land air sea.) then this is the book for you. If you are satisfied with just 'mech combat...you may want to save your money for something else.

The book is neatly divided into chapters similar to the introduction rules set except that it now includes ALL unit types. Movement will show you how 'mechs, infantry, vehicles, aircraft, etc... move rather than simply just mechs. This repeats itself for each chapter before entering chapters that detail the specific unit types and weaponry. At the end of the book there are several tables (that may also be downloaded from Catalyst for free) that help you organize everything in the book and to provide quick reference during play.

I first started with the Introduction Box. After that I got Sword and Dragon along with the map compilation sets. After picking up this book I began to introduce the new units and rules into our games at home, and my friends and I can never see ourselves going back to "simple" Battletech. Battletech has become our tactical wargame of choice.
